BE PART OF THE FESTIVAL OF TOMORROW: 13-21 FEBRUARY 2026

The Festival of Tomorrow blends the creative arts with research and innovation to explore the ideas that will shape our shared future.

We work with partners from academia, industry, government, charities and the arts to create opportunities for everyone to engage with knowledge, research, innovation and creativity - and how they can shape our choices in a changing world.

We do this through cutting edge exhibitions, spectacular art installations, hands-on activities talks, shows and workshops and content that our visitors of all ages and backgrounds find surprising, entertaining, inspiring and accessible.

Making the Festival of Tomorrow happen wouldn’t be possible without the help of our volunteers. Whether it’s manning an information point, getting hands on with creative activities, helping to manage smooth running of talks and demonstrations, or providing a warm welcome for visitors, event volunteers play a vital role in making the festival happen. 

For some people it’s the excitement of event day and meeting new people. For others, it’s developing new skills and being ‘behind the scenes’ at talks and events. But most of all our volunteers are passionate about helping to inspire the next generation of scientists, researchers, engineers and creative minds. 

WHAT WOULD YOU BE DOING?

We need a team of friendly, engaging people to help visitors to have a brilliant experience. As one of our volunteer team, you may be asked to:

  • Welcome visitors to events and exhibits
  • Help direct visitors between venues
  • Hand out programmes or other literature
  • Provide information for visitors - especially about what they can see, do and get involved with
  • Help with queue management and visitor flow around a venue
  • Help steward talks, shows and performances
  • Help with set up and clear down for talks and demonstrations
  • Keep a tally of the numbers of visitors in exhibition and event spaces 
  • Act as runner for assisting with queries from exhibitors and performers
  • Help with directing visitors & exhibitors to car-parking spaces
  • Assist with completing photography/videography consent forms with visitors
  • Encourage visitors to complete feedback surveys
We're also looking for volunteers who are happy to get stuck in to helping out with specific activities, such as:
  • Helping to run arts and crafts activities for families
  • Helping exhibitors with demonstrations or interactive activities

WHERE AND WHEN?

The Festival of Tomorrow takes place across multiple venues around Swindon between 9-21 February 2026.

These include Steam - The Museum of the Great Western Railway, Swindon Designer Outlet, the Carriage Works, the Brunel shopping centre, the Deanery CE Academy, among others. 

We are now particularily in need of help on Sunday 15th, Friday 20th and Saturday 21st February,  but always welcome help at our daytime activities over the half-term week 14-21 February.

We'd also welcome a few helpers to lend a hand with getting set up on Friday 13 February.

WHAT SKILLS, EXPERIENCE AND ATTRIBUTES DO YOU NEED?

Along with having great communication and interpersonal skills, we ask that you are:

  • Flexible and happy to get stuck in
  • Willing to become familiar with and then follow the Fire Safety Procedures and Health and Safety Procedures at all times, including supporting the evacuation of visitors in an emergency
  • Enthusiastic about research, science or the creative arts and the aims of the Festival of Tomorrow
  • Willing to work as part of a team.
  • Willing to work outside for limited periods, if needed (eg helping direct visitors in the car park at the busiest times)
